ALEXANDRIA, Va., March 24 -- United States Patent no. 12,587,088, issued on March 24, was assigned to Synopsys Inc. (Sunnyvale, Calif.).

"Negative discharge circuit" was invented by Arpit Vijayvergia (Bhopal, India), Rahul Gupta (Faridabad, India) and Nitin Bansal (Gurgaon, India).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A circuit includes a control circuit branch and a discharge circuit branch. The control circuit branch is electrically coupled between a control input node and a negative node. The control circuit branch includes a p-type transistor (MP), a diode, and a first n-type transistor (MN1). A source node of MP is electrically coupled to the control input node.
